CVE-2019-0278

CVE-2019-0278 is a medium-severity vulnerability in Sap Netweaver Process Integration with a CVSS 3.x base score of 4.3.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low.

Key facts

Description

Under certain conditions the Monitoring Servlet of the SAP NetWeaver Process Integration (Messaging System), fixed in versions 7.10 to 7.11, 7.20, 7.30, 7.31, 7.40, 7.50, allows an attacker to see the names of database tables used by the application, leading to information disclosure.

How severe is CVE-2019-0278?
CVE-2019-0278 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 4.3, rated medium severity. It is exploitable over network with low attack complexity, requires low priv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is low, integrity none, and availability none.
Is CVE-2019-0278 being actively exploited?
It is not currently listed in CISA's KEV catalog. Its EPSS exploit-prediction score is 1% (49th percentile), an estimate of the probability of exploitation in the next 30 days.
